The narrative shifts when Mr. Wolf accidentally performs a good deed and experiences a physical "tingle" of joy. This moment is pivotal because it separates his identity from his actions. He discovers that being "good" provides a type of fulfillment that the thrill of a heist cannot match. However, the film cleverly avoids a simple "lightbulb" moment; Wolf’s journey is messy and filled with backsliding, highlighting that unlearning years of defensive behavior is a difficult process.
